- A regional ocean database for the Coastal China Sea. Wang, Cece Su, Bei Sun, Jun Hu, Xiaoke Liu, Jihua Access to high-quality marine geophysical and biogeochemical in-situ data poses a challenge for model evaluation and parameter calibration of the Coastal China Sea (CCS). We describe a new regional ocean database for CCS (RODCCS) with original data from six repositories. The database covers the region of 116-135°E in longitude and 20-42°N in latitude, which embraces the Bohai Sea, the Yellow Sea, the East China Sea and a part of the Sea of Japan. About 3.9 million data points are collected and sorted according to variable types, including temperature, salinity, dissolved oxygen, silicate, nitrate, nitrite, ammonium, phosphate, Chlorophyll a, dissolved inorganic carbon, dissolved organic carbon, and particulate organic carbon. These data are quality-controlled (QCed) with six QC checks and stored in a Network Common Data Format (NetCDF) file. RODCCS includes twelve NetCDF files, each with a unified structure. The database is easily accessed and of high quality after QC checks, making it suitable for a wide range of marine modelling as well as field research for the CCS.
